Traders and developers using MetaTrader 4 often struggle with compiled ex4 files. Our advanced ex4 file decompiler offers a strong solution. It helps recover source code with great precision and reliability. Now, professional programmers and trading strategy designers can unlock their trading indicators and Expert Advisors’ full potential.
Decompiling ex4 files needs special knowledge and tools. Our top-notch ex4 file decompiler makes complex reverse engineering tasks easier. It lets users understand and tweak trading scripts with ease.
Our decompiler is made for MetaTrader 4 fans. It supports detailed code recovery techniques for many programming issues. Whether you’re an experienced developer or a curious trader, our tool excels in getting back the original MQL4 source code.
Key Takeaways
- Advanced decompilation of ex4 trading files
- User-friendly interface for code recovery
- Support for complex MetaTrader 4 scripts
- Professional-grade reverse engineering capabilities
- Comprehensive source code extraction
Understanding Ex4 Files and Their Structure
Ex4 files are a special type of binary file used in software development and reverse engineering. They hold compiled MetaTrader Expert Advisor (EA) scripts. These scripts are complex trading algorithms used in financial markets. To analyze ex4 files well, you need to understand their detailed structure.
Today, there are powerful tools for developers and analysts to explore ex4 files. These tools help us see the detailed architecture of ex4 files. This architecture is key to protecting intellectual property and keeping code safe.
Core Components of Ex4 File Architecture
The ex4 file architecture has several important parts:
- Compiled binary code
- Metadata headers
- Instruction sets
- Memory management markers
Binary Code Organization Principles
The binary code in ex4 files is organized to improve performance and keep source code safe. Its compact design allows for fast execution and strong encryption.
Binary Code Attribute | Characteristics |
---|---|
Compression Level | High-density encoding |
Access Protection | Multilayer encryption |
Performance Optimization | Streamlined instruction mapping |
Protection Mechanisms in Ex4 Files
Developers use advanced protection mechanisms to keep intellectual property safe in ex4 files. These measures stop unauthorized code extraction and reverse engineering.
- Advanced encryption algorithms
- Obfuscation techniques
- Dynamic code scrambling
- Runtime integrity checks
Knowing about these complex structures helps us analyze ex4 files better. It gives us a peek into the world of protecting compiled software.
The Importance of Ex4 File Decompilation
Ex4 reverse engineering is key in forex trading and software development. It helps developers and traders understand trading algorithms. Decompiling ex4 files lets them analyze, optimize, and improve strategies.
There are several reasons to decompile ex4 files:
- Recovering lost source code when original scripts are unavailable
- Analyzing existing trading indicators for performance enhancement
- Debugging complex trading algorithms
- Understanding proprietary trading strategies
Ex4 reverse engineering gives traders deep insights into trading mechanisms. Professional traders can dissect and learn from sophisticated trading algorithms. This helps them gain an edge in the fast-paced forex market.
Security researchers and developers use ex4 decompilation for:
- Identifying potential vulnerabilities in trading software
- Verifying the integrity of trading algorithms
- Developing more robust and efficient trading tools
By unlocking ex4 files, developers can turn complex binary code into understandable source code. This opens doors for innovation and strategic improvement in trading technology.
Key Features of Our Ex4 File Decompiler
Developers and programmers looking for a top-notch ex4 extraction tool will find our solution perfect. It’s designed to tackle tough code challenges. Our decompiler is special because it turns complex ex4 files into easy-to-read code.
The ex4 extraction tool has many advanced features that make it stand out. It’s different from other decompilation software in many ways:
Advanced Code Recovery Capabilities
Our tool is great at pulling out complex binary structures with high accuracy. It has key features like:
- High-accuracy code reconstruction
- Deep binary analysis algorithms
- Keeping the original code logic
- Support for many programming environments
User-Friendly Interface Design
The interface is made for both new and experienced developers. It makes decompiling easy. Intuitive controls and clear navigation help users of all skill levels.
Batch Processing Options
Our tool is efficient and powerful with batch processing. Now, you can decompile many ex4 files at once. This saves a lot of time.
Feature | Capability | Time Savings |
---|---|---|
Single File Decompilation | Standard Processing | 5-10 minutes |
Batch Processing | Multiple File Decompilation | 30-50% Reduction |
Our ex4 extraction tool combines the latest technology with a focus on the user. It offers unmatched performance for software experts.
Step-by-Step Guide to Decompiling Ex4 Files
Decompiling ex4 files needs a careful plan to get the code right and lose little data. Our detailed guide shows you how to decompile ex4 files well and fast.
- Prepare Your Decompilation Environment
- Install the latest version of our ex4 file decompiler
- Make sure your system has the needed hardware
- Set up a special area for working on files
- File Selection and Verification
- Pick the ex4 file you want to decompile
- Do checks to make sure the file is okay
- Save the original file before you start
- Decompilation Process
- Start the decompiler tool
- Set up how you want to decompile
- Start extracting the ex4 file
When you decompile ex4 files, you must pay close attention. It’s about turning complex binary code into something you can read. This needs special tools and a lot of knowledge.
Decompilation Stage | Key Actions | Expected Outcome |
---|---|---|
Initialization | File verification | Confirm file compatibility |
Code Extraction | Binary analysis | Generate readable source code |
Refinement | Code optimization | Clean and structured output |
Experts know that decompiling ex4 files takes time and care. Our tool makes this hard task easier for both new and seasoned programmers.
Pro Tip: Always work with a clean, isolated environment when decompiling ex4 files to prevent potential system contamination.
Common Challenges in Ex4 Unpacking
Working with ex4 files can be tricky for developers and analysts. It’s key to know these challenges to use an ex4 unpacker well.
For pro-level ex4 unpacking, you need smart strategies. There are three main hurdles that need special skills and tools.
Dealing with Encrypted Files
Encrypted ex4 files are big hurdles for simple decompilation. A top-notch ex4 unpacker must have strong decryption tools. These tools should:
- Crack tough encryption codes
- Spot unique encryption signs
- Keep the code’s original structure
Handling Corrupted Ex4 Files
Fixing damaged or broken ex4 files needs special care. Good ex4 unpackers should have:
- Smart file fix algorithms
- Systems to keep metadata safe
- Tools to find and fix errors
Resolving Compatibility Issues
Software and MetaTrader versions can cause problems. Top ex4 unpacking tools should be flexible. They should:
- Work with many programming setups
- Adjust to different operating systems
- Keep decompilation quality steady
Knowing and tackling these big challenges helps developers tackle ex4 file extraction and analysis.
Advanced Ex4 Reverse Engineering Techniques
Ex4 reverse engineering needs advanced methods, not just basic decompilation. Experts use complex strategies to uncover binary structures and find key code insights.
Some main techniques in ex4 reverse engineering are:
- Code flow analysis to grasp program logic
- Pattern recognition to spot common code patterns
- Symbol table reconstruction for clearer code
- Dynamic runtime analysis to track program behavior
Advanced ex4 reverse engineering requires a lot of technical know-how. Experts use special tools to get past code obfuscation. Advanced decompilers use machine learning to guess and rebuild original code.
Successful reverse engineering needs a mix of strategies:
- Find the core binary architecture
- Map memory allocation patterns
- Spot encryption mechanisms
- Rebuild logical code sequences
The aim of ex4 reverse engineering is more than just getting code. It’s about fully understanding software design, finding vulnerabilities, and the underlying computation.
Security Considerations When Using Ex4 Extraction Tools
Working with software decompilation needs a careful look at security and legal rules. An ex4 extraction tool has strong abilities that need to be used wisely and ethically.
Developers and researchers must know the big security issues with ex4 file decompilation. Keeping intellectual property safe and following the law are key when using these tools.
Legal Implications of Code Extraction
Users of an ex4 extraction tool need to know the legal limits:
- Respect software copyright laws
- Get the right permission before decompiling private code
- Know the rules about intellectual property
- Check if you follow the licensing rules
Data Protection Measures
It’s crucial to have strong security steps when dealing with sensitive code:
Protection Strategy | Key Actions |
---|---|
Encryption | Lock the code with strong encryption |
Access Control | Only let approved people see the code |
Audit Trails | Keep detailed logs of all extraction actions |
“With great technological power comes great responsibility” – Cybersecurity Principle
By being proactive about security, experts can use ex4 extraction tools safely. This way, they avoid big risks and legal issues.
Comparing Different Ex4 Decompression Software Options
Finding the right ex4 decompression software can be tough. Developers and reverse engineering experts face many choices. Each option has its own strengths and weaknesses.
When picking ex4 decompression software, there are key things to think about:
- Code recovery accuracy
- Processing speed
- User interface complexity
- Compatibility with different file versions
- Additional reverse engineering features
Top ex4 decompression software is great at getting and analyzing binary code. Advanced tools offer comprehensive decompilation processes that keep data safe and code structures intact.
When choosing ex4 decompression software, consider these:
- Precision of code reconstruction
- Support for multiple programming environments
- Security features protecting sensitive information
- Cost-effectiveness and licensing options
Developers should look for ex4 decompression software that’s both powerful and easy to use. The best option should make code extraction smooth. It should also keep data safe and perform well.
Best Practices for Ex4 File Analysis
Effective ex4 file analysis needs a careful plan. It must ensure accuracy and a full understanding of the code. Experts must use strong methods to handle the complex tasks of ex4 file checking.
To master ex4 file analysis, you need to use smart documentation and quality checks. These steps help keep your reverse engineering work safe and reliable.
Documentation Methods for Precise Tracking
Keeping detailed records is key for good ex4 file analysis. Developers should write down:
- Changes in code structure
- Challenges faced during decompilation
- Important code discoveries
- Security risks found
Quality Assurance Steps
Quality checks are vital to make sure decompiled ex4 files are trustworthy. Follow these important steps:
- Try decompiling several times
- Check against the original binary signatures
- Test the code thoroughly
- Record any odd code behaviors
Professional ex4 file analysis requires careful attention to detail and a clear plan for documentation and checks.
Troubleshooting Common Ex4 Decompiler Issues
Working with an ex4 file decompiler can be tough for developers and traders. They often face specific problems that need special fixes. These issues happen when dealing with MetaTrader 4 compiled files.
When you use an ex4 file decompiler, you might run into a few common problems. These can stop you from doing your work:
- Incomplete code reconstruction
- Syntax errors during decompilation
- Compatibility problems with different MetaTrader versions
- Performance limitations with complex scripts
To solve these problems, you need a smart plan. It’s important to know what’s causing the issue and how to fix it.
Issue | Potential Solution |
---|---|
Incomplete Decompilation | Verify file integrity and use advanced recovery modes |
Syntax Errors | Check MetaTrader version compatibility |
Performance Bottlenecks | Optimize decompiler settings and use batch processing |
Professional ex4 file decompilers have strong error detection and recovery tools. They help solve these tough problems.
“Effective troubleshooting is about understanding the underlying technical constraints and implementing targeted solutions.” – Trading Software Expert
By using these smart strategies, developers can reduce problems. They can also make their ex4 file decompilation work better.
Professional Tips for Successful Ex4 Unpacking
Mastering the ex4 unpacking utility needs smart strategies and technical skills. Experts know that decompiling files is more than just using a tool. It’s about setting up your environment right and knowing the challenges ahead for accurate results.
Effective ex4 unpacking strategies include:
- Make sure your system works with the ex4 unpacking utility
- Make detailed backup files before you start decompiling
- Keep your decompiler up to date
- Check the file’s integrity before unpacking
For complex ex4 files, experts recommend a step-by-step method. Understanding file protection and encryption helps a lot. They use different checks to make sure they get the code right.
Precision in ex4 file unpacking requires patience, technical knowledge, and the right tools.
Advanced users suggest a structured process:
- First, assess the file
- Then, prepare your environment
- Choose which parts to decompile
- Verify the code
- Document your findings
By using these tips, developers can get the most out of their ex4 unpacking utility. They’ll get better results in different technical situations.
Integration with Other Development Tools
Developers looking for top-notch ex4 decompiler freeware need tools that work well together. Our ex4 decompiler makes it easy to connect with many development tools. This makes complex reverse engineering tasks simpler.
Good tool integration boosts software development speed. Our ex4 decompiler works well with many platforms and development systems.
Workflow Optimization Strategies
Improving workflow integration involves several key steps:
- Automated script generation
- Instant code translation
- Simplified debugging processes
- Rapid development cycle acceleration
Compatible Software Solutions
Our ex4 decompiler freeware fits well with many software systems:
Software Category | Compatible Tools | Integration Level |
---|---|---|
Code Editors | Visual Studio Code, Eclipse | High |
Version Control | Git, SVN | Medium |
Debugging Platforms | WinDbg, OllyDbg | Advanced |
Developers can use our ex4 decompiler to build more efficient, connected development environments. This is done with little setup hassle.
Conclusion
Exploring MetaTrader 4 indicators and Expert Advisors is complex. A strong ex4 file decompiler is key. It turns encrypted code into insights you can use. Our tool breaks through old software limits, giving traders and developers a deep look into trading strategies.
Looking into ex4 file analysis shows the power of special decompression tech. Our decompiler is top-notch, tackling encryption, compatibility, and reverse engineering. It lets developers see how trading algorithms work with ease.
For those wanting to understand MetaTrader 4 tools better, our decompiler is a must-have. It makes complex code easy to get and use. This helps traders improve their strategies, find problems, and get insights that change their trading game.
Ready to upgrade your trading tech? Download our ex4 file decompiler. It’s your ticket to advanced code analysis and a lead in algorithmic trading. Start your journey to mastering trading tools today.